The "Z" is more stable, generally speaking. The "Z" plastic is a lot more uniform. The original "X" plastic Cyclone was VERY color dependent with lighter colors being less stable and darker more stable. I was a huge fan, as the Cyclone was a quantum leap in design. The most stable was Dark purple. I had a matched pair that flew like new Vipers(Innova's hottest fastest at the time, The motto for the Viper was "Fear no wind, Crush the Viper!") I actually preferred powder Blue Cyclones to all others. It was probably the first disc I threw over 450 ft. Went out and threw the ESP Cyclone tonight. I recommend this disc as a user friendly driver. VERY straight, and comparatively fast, the Cyclone has enough speed to go long, but I think that it will be a lot easier to control than the super speed discs that fall off( hyzer out). Discraft has come pretty close to the original with the one I was throwing. Pretty much line drive straight past the range I'd normally throw an XL, Buzz, or Storm. This may lighten the load I carry. We'll see, but right now it looks promising.
